想快速掌握 datediff 函数?别急,让我带你
一步步拆解它。 我曾经在处理一个大型数据库项目时,需要计算用户注册日期与最近一次登录日期之间的时间差,当时就深深体会到 datediff 函数的重要性。 它不像看起来那么简单,实际操作中会遇到一些小坑。

DATEDIFF 函数的核心在于计算两个日期之间的时间间隔。它的语法很简单:DATEDIFF(datepart, startdate, enddate)。 datepart 指定你要计算的时间单位,比如 year、month、day、hour、minute、second;startdate 和 enddate 分别是你的起始日期和结束日期。
举个例子,假设你想计算 2025年1月1日 到 2025年1月1日之间相隔多少天:
DATEDIFF(day, '2025-01-01', '2025-01-01')
这会返回 365。 看起来很直观,对吧?
Seede AI
AI 驱动的设计工具
713
查看详情
但实际应用中,你可能会遇到一些问题。 比如,我曾经犯过一个错误,就是日期格式不正确。 数据库系统对日期格式很敏感,如果你的日期格式与系统设置的不一致,就会导致错误的结果,甚至报错。 我当时花了半天时间才找到这个问题,最后发现是日期字符串的格式不对,改成 YYYY-MM-DD 后就一切正常了。 所以,一定要确保你的日期格式正确,并且与你的数据库系统兼容。
另一个需要注意的地方是 datepart 的选择。 如果你想计算两个日期之间的月数,使用 month 作为 datepart。 但需要注意的是,DATEDIFF 计算的是完整月份的数量。 比如,从 2025年1月15日 到 2025年2月10日,DATEDIFF(month, '2025-01-15', '2025-02-10') 返回的结果是 0,因为没有完整的月份经过。 这与我们日常理解的“相差一个月”有所不同,需要特别注意。 如果需要更精确的月份计算,可能需要更复杂的逻辑。
最后,推荐你搜索一些视频教程,很多视频会更直观地演示 DATEDIFF 函数的用法,并结合实际案例讲解,这样能更快上手。 记住,实践出真知,多练习才能真正掌握这个函数。 别忘了仔细检查你的日期格式和 datepart 的选择,这能避免很多不必要的麻烦。
以上就是datediff函数怎么用视频的详细内容,更多请关注其它相关文章!
# 一个月
# 永丰网站推广注意事项
# 团队推广app接单网站
# seo怎么写才能过关
# 蜘蛛池seo顾问
# 太原关键词排名计划优化
# 对网站推广优化的好处
# 清涧中小网站建设平台
# 网站建设怎么更好
# 台商开发区果蔬网站推广
# 砂锅土豆粉怎样营销推广
# 这个问题
# datediff函数
# 你要
# 我曾经
# 让我
# 就会
# 镜像文件
# 需要注意
# 你想
# 的是
# overflow
# datediff
相关栏目:
【
企业资讯168 】
【
行业动态50218 】
【
媒体报道120512 】
相关推荐:
负市盈率是什么意思
如何开发typescript
域名解析后为什么要进行域名备案
debian和ubuntu的区别是什么
typescript怎么写react
openwrt有什么用
typescript是什么类型的语言
光刻机的分类及其优缺点
如何选择启用固态硬盘
春运抢票最新技巧与方法
power在坐标轴中是什么意思
苹果16有哪些自带配件
linux如何合并分区命令
typescript掌握哪些可以做项目
power在充电器上是什么意思
win10如何开启命令行
j*a怎么讲数组打印
空调控制面板power灯一直亮是什么意思
品道音响上的power键是什么意思
市盈率tt的扣非是什么意思
dos命令 如何将变量 作为路径的一部分
如何查看固态硬盘速度
阿里云盘扩容工具怎么用
51单片机怎么连接端口
如何使用ping命令
锤子手机怎么不出5g
什么是域名解析地址
nosql数据库的应用场景有哪些
j*a里怎么输入数组
8英寸等于多少厘米
如何用固态硬盘做缓存
typescript如何标记私有方法
单片机怎么计算0xf0
苹果16如何预购
单片机速度怎么看
得物上怎么样申请退换货 得物上退换货详细指南(包含海外)
如何以管理员身份打开cmd命令行窗口
选哪个折叠屏手机好用
夸克内测有什么好处
学typescript需要什么基础么
ai文件里无法找到链接文件怎么解决
推特是什么软件国内可以使用吗
市盈率负值是什么意思
苹果16主打颜色有哪些
typescript为什么能运行
一尺是多少厘米
nfc功能是什么意思怎么开启
如何查看win10版本命令行
春运抢票需要什么软件抢
js怎么设置typescript


